1.0.3 firmware for the iPod Classic annoys me. First, they don't sort my TV video files, which were ripped from DVDs, by episode number, but by date added (I guess I forgot to handbrake a couple of episodes) per season. eg, i have season 7 of friends but i added episode 14 last. episode 1 is the very last one on my list and 14 is the first. it used to be ordered by episode number which is much more convenient.

A much more annoying thing is that my Phillips Portable DVD/iPod Player no longer is compatible when playing videos (ie the video is no longer displayed on the larger screen), only audio. Granted, it's not 100% compatible (i have to skip the alphabetically ordered videos to the right movie file).

So now that I'm done ranting, is there a way I can downgrade back to 1.0.2? Because I dropped like 170 dollars on that portable ipod player and i don wanna watch on a 2.5" when I know there is a 8.5 staring back at me.

Yes, you can, but there is one catch. You will need to format your ipod, so therefore backup ALL DATA on your IPOD. You have been warned.

Follow this guide:
http://spr33.co.uk/wp/archives/downgrading-apple-ipod-firmware-102-101

BUT! Watch out for steps 4-6 because as you can see this guide is really for
downgrading from 1.02 to 1.01. So when you reach step 5, instead of downloading the guides firmware file(which is 1.01), download the 1.02 firmware file(http://www.mediafire.com/?0ysymxbxngw) and 1.02 signature file(http://www.mediafire.com/?57x2sruyjdv). I know this is alot of info, so if you are confused at all, ill give you a step by step.:D

Note: When you get to step 4, if you see iPod_24.1.0.3.ipsw’ and ‘iPod_24.1.0.3.ipsw.signature that is okay, just delete those files then continue.

I Downgraded to 1.0.2 and I still can't run my iPod through my Sonic Video55 dock

I have had the same issue and thought that reverting to version 1.0.2 would work. I had been able to play my videos before. I reinstalled version 1.0.2 today though and I still can't play the videos. The screen just says "TV Out Enabled Please Connect Video Accessory". Does anyone know what else could be the problem?

I have since resolved my problem. After I reverted to 1.0.2 I set the TV out to on. I then went back to my video and played it on my iPod. While it was playing I attached it to the Sonic and the video played on the dock. I hope this is helpful to others, I spent days trying to get this sorted out.

Follow up to my last post regarding the ability to downgrade to 1.0.2. I recently used my 160g classic with the sonic v55 on a recent vacation. It worked great but a trick needs to be done. while the v55 is OFF, make sure the setting on the ipod-tv out- is on, you pop in the classic, select the show, THEN turn the v55 ON....I have both the 1.0.1 and 1.0.2 firmware and signatures available if anyone needs it.
